Florida Senior Consulting, the state’s leading privately-owned senior advocacy and placement firm, has donated $2,000 to the Dr. Piper Center for Social Services in support of the organization’s Christmas Celebration.

In honor of the season of giving, Florida Senior Consulting has launched an ongoing partnership with the Dr. Piper Center, including an initial monetary contribution and support of the organization’s toy drive. On Dec. 11, Florida Senior Consulting assembled bicycles for the Christmas Celebration, which will go to children visiting the Dr. Piper Center on Christmas morning.

The $2,000 donation will help to continue the mission of Dr. Ella Mae Piper and the Dr. Piper Center to positively impact Fort Myers seniors and children. Beyond the support of Dr. Piper Center’s Christmas Celebration, an annual event that brightens the holidays for at-risk children in Lee County, Florida Senior Consulting will utilize its preexisting audience of seniors to further the Dr. Piper Center’s mission of empowering and improving the quality of life for local seniors.

“We see true value in the Dr. Piper Center and the way it contributes to low-income seniors, and Florida Senior Consulting believes deeply in the act of giving back to the senior community that we work with,” said Rachel Byrd, regional manager of Florida Senior Consulting in Lee and Collier counties. “We want to make the Dr. Piper Center’s voice heard—that is our gift to them this holiday season.”

The Dr. Piper Center’s goal is to enhance the social and economic wellbeing of individuals 55 and older, as well as at-risk youth and children with special needs who reside in the Fort Myers community. The organization has several programs that serve seniors, including senior companions, who provide personal assistance and friendship to seniors, and senior employment, which provides education and learning opportunities to seniors.

Florida Senior Consulting’s partnership with the Dr. Piper Center began in mid-November and will include ongoing financial support and the use of its audience to spread the word about Dr. Piper Center’s programs and the need for more senior volunteers.
